Life can take us down many roads filled with rollercoasters, obstacles, and hurdles. Often, roadblocks prevent us from having a smooth journey. As we travel the Samaritan Road, we will discover that we all may be in a state of recovery. Sometimes, we can be robbed, stripped, and left to die on these roads: at times. life can also bind us. and we need to become free in order to experience true healing.
The Samaritan Road journey is based on the parable Jesus taught, found in Luke 10:25-37. In life, we might be attacked by bandits. passed by the church system, and still receive help along the way.
We often make unhealthy decisions that can become the pathway to the roads we travel. However, the Samaritan approach provides an avenue for healing and recovery-offering a different journey of healing, freedom, and wholeness.
